Error w/ 6.82 B6 on obfuscated posting with no extensions:

Postby saintsinner » Sat Jun 01, 2019 6:26 am

I've only noticed this a few times, but after downloading all the parts newsbin removes the listing from the downloading files list BUT continues to repair/rebuild/create the file (you can see this under task manager, or if you have other normal files queued up it will download them but won't move on to unpacking/repairing until it's done with the previous obscured file. Which (at least for my settings) is exactly what it should do, the only problem being the premature moving of the in process file. It's not an urgent problem nor does it effect usability or speed, it's just.... odd.

Re: Error w/ 6.82 B6 on obfuscated posting with no extension

Postby Quade » Sat Jun 01, 2019 8:35 am

Files that aren't grouped get removed from the download list directly so, repair and unrar will happen in the background. I think that's what you're commenting on. Correct me if I'm wrong. I don't see any fix for this. One solution might be to generate an NZB from the files and feed that into the download list because that will "force group" the files. If you're already using an NZB, don't feed it to the post list, instead feed it to the download list directly because again this will force group them.

Re: Error w/ 6.82 B6 on obfuscated posting with no extension

Postby Quade » Sun Jun 02, 2019 12:44 pm

You can automate all of that.

1 - Create an NZB Watch folder in Newsbin.

2 - Give it an unrar path that includes $(NZBFILE) "X:\NZBS\$(NZBFILE)\" for example.

3 - Now any NZB saved to this folder will get loaded into the download list, download and end up in a folder named for the NZB.

You can also tell Newsbin to automatically download all double-clicked NZB's. It's in the NZB Options. If you do that, you might want to make the main unrar older include $(NZBFILE). You can make multiple NZB Watch folders to control where the files end up too.
